WARRIORS CANT OVERCOME SLOW START

BARBERTON OH- West Branch made their sixth trip to regionals in the last 10 seasons on Tuesday night. The Warriors were coming off a big district championship win over conference rival Marlington. Norton stood in their way of making a trip to the regional final.

The Panthers came out of the gates and hit a three before you could blink. That set the tone for the whole first frame, as Norton had the energy, and the Warriors were fighting against momentum. Morton’s 13-2 lead after one frame was really all they needed. The game stayed pretty even after that point. West Branch won the second quarter, but only by a point taking a 18-8 deficit into the locker room.

In the second half, even though the Warriors came out firing cutting the lead to 18-13 in their first two possessions, the Panthers kept their patient offense in cruise control. Norton would hang on to win 36-31.

Sophie Gregory and Anna Lippiatt both held the team lead in points for West Branch with 8 a piece.
